出 处:《中国港湾建设》2023年第12期41-45,共5页China Harbour Engineering
摘 要:海南陵水新村潟湖口外滩槽稳定性差,制约了潟湖的整治和开发利用,为了研究潟湖口外滩槽的演变规律,结合潟湖的地形地貌、海岸动力和泥沙冲淤特点,通过对比潟湖近30 a的遥感影像资料,分析了潟湖口外海岸线、浅滩及深槽的冲淤变化,研究表明潟湖口外潮汐汊道深槽主轴线不稳定,周围岸滩亦存在强烈的冲淤变化,滩槽地貌一直处于单通道和双通道的相互演变之中,一个相对完整的演变期大约需要经历10~20 a左右的时间,波流作用下自东向西的沿岸输沙以及台风等极端事件影响是造成滩槽变化的重要原因。The poor stability of the shoal-channel outside the Lingshui Xincun lagoon estuary in Hainan restricts the regulation,development and utilization of the lagoon.In order to study the evolution characteristics of the shoal-channel outside of the lagoon estuary,combined with the topography and geomorphology,coastal dynamics and sediment transportation of the lagoon,compared the remote sensing image data of the lagoon in the past 30 years,the silting changes of the coastline,shoals and deep channel outside the lagoon estuary were analyzed.The study shows that the main axis of the deep channel of the tidal inlet outside the lagoon estuary is unstable,and there are also strong erosion and sedimentation changes in the surrounding shoals.The shoal-channel landform has been in the mutual evolution of single channel and double channel,a relatively complete evolution period takes about 10 to 20 years.The coastal sand transport from east to west under the action of wave and flow,and the impact of extreme events such as typhoons are important reasons for the changes of shoal-channel.
